I'm just a gym shoe

I'm just a gym shoe, nobody respects me,
I'm all untied, and kids neglect me.
I have mud on my strings, and poop on my bottom,
I've seen no cleaning tools, like my user forgot em'.
I'm constantly stepped on, every day,
I'm used to my capacity, in every known way.
People run in me, work in me, and throw me around,
But I'm content with this life, so I don't make a sound.
My owner lets the dog, chew up my skin,
Now covered in slobber, with holes in my chin.
I constantly get lost, often left in the heat,
When all I want to do is hold some feet.
I have a distant cousin, his name is loafer,
He's treated like royalty, in a box, driven chauffeur.Â
He often gets polished, he also gets washed,
While I am dirty all the time, getting trampled and squashed.
Even my sister gets better treatment than me,
She's a tutu shoe, and everyone wants to see.
As her user dances a ballet so crisp,
The audience applauds my sisters usefulness.
Do I get applauded for standing firm,
When my user hikes trails, and I work full-term?
While IÂ grip the ground, to ensure he runs fast,
Do I get recognition for the test I just passed?
My big brother Boot went off to the war,
He just sent me a message that he feels kinda sore.
But he holds the feet of a hero, fighting for our rights,
Traveling the world, and witnessing great sights.
But I'm just a gym shoe, I don't get special perks,
I'm not satisfied with life, because it never works.
My life is so dismal, thank God I'm idle,
Cause if I was alive I'd be surely suicidal.Â
       I'm just a gym shoe.
